Amnesty International Urges Hungary to Arrest Netanyahu Over War Crimes

Occupied Palestine (Quds News Network)-
Amnesty International has called on Hungary to arrest and surrender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u to the International Criminal Court (ICC) if he visits Budapest on Wednesday. The human rights organization said that hosting Netanyahu would violate international law and embolden Israel to commit more crimes against Palestinians.
